Secured Personal Loan

A secured personal loan is distinct for its use of collateral and it also requires a fixed interest rate and a fixed payment scheme. To enjoy the benefits of a secured personal loan, you should have a property of your own to provide security for the lender that you will pay your loan in time. If not, your property will surely be out of your hands. But don’t worry because most lenders are not really interested with any property. They are interested with the money you will have to pay them back. One of the advantages of getting a secured personal loan is the fast and easy approval of your loan request. Since you have your own property that will be used as collateral for the loan, the lender will feel at ease and be convinced that you can really pay him back. This type of loan has also a lower interest rate compared to the unsecured loan. This will also provide you with higher amount of loan and longer years to pay the loan. Unsecured Loan

Unlike the secured loan, the unsecured loan can be obtained even without you having collateral. But you must have a good credit history so that your loan application can be approved by the lender. You must understand that the lender puts on risk on this type of loan than in the secured loan. So, he must also make sure that the borrower is capable of paying his loan without the collateral. The advantage of an unsecured loan is the lesser risk you have to suffer. But don’t ever think that you can escape from paying your lender. He always has the way on how to get his money and the interest back from you. The most difficult part in the unsecured loan could be the difficulty of getting the loan since you still have to undergo a lot of process and evaluation before the lender grants your loan request.
